The call of the muezzin : : studies in astronomical timekeeping and instrumentation in medieval Islamic civilization : (studies I-IX) / / by David King.

King (history of science, F.W. Goethe U., Frankfurt, Germany), in the first of two volumes, presents an analysis of over 500 manuscripts that document the use of the sun and stars to keep time, an essential task in determining the hour of prayer, which is called by the muezzin in the Islamic world....
